A 23-year-old Beit Shemesh resident was arrested overnight in Jerusalem's Armon HaNatziv neighborhood on suspicion of drug trafficking. Police found suspected drugs and NIS 5,500 in cash in his vehicle, which they suspect is linked to criminal activity. The arrest was made by Jerusalem district police. The Zioneer has reported on several similar drug-related arrests across the country in recent weeks, including in Tel Aviv, Jerusalem, and Hadera, highlighting ongoing police efforts against drug trafficking. The suspect is expected to be brought before a court for a remand hearing.
